A brief description of British Airways (BA) primarily operates out of Terminal 5 at Heathrow International Airport, known for its modern facilities and efficient services. As BA's main hub, Terminal 5 ensures a seamless travel experience for passengers flying to various global destinations. Travelers can check in online up to 24 hours before their flight, benefiting from numerous self-service kiosks and dedicated counters that reduce wait times. The terminal features a range of amenities, including luxury lounges like the British Airways Galleries Club Lounge, along with diverse dining options and shops. Security processes are generally efficient, and once through, passengers can enjoy a selection of duty-free stores. For those connecting to other flights, Terminal 5 is designed for quick transfers, with clear signage and helpful staff. Additionally, the terminal is well-connected to central London via the Heathrow Express, the Piccadilly Line, and various bus services.
